-
Notifications
You must be signed in to change notification settings - Fork 8
Upgrade and removal
Wiki Pusher edited this page Nov 16, 2025
·
1 revision
On every upgrade, the command linuxmuster-linuxclient7 upgrade is executed. It does the following:
- Check if linuxmuster-linuxclient7 is set up
- Upgrade config files if required:
-
/etc/linuxmuster-linuxclient7/network.conf->/etc/linuxmuster-linuxclient7/config.yml
- Apply all templates.
- Restart services.
- Delete old files which could cause conflicts
When the package is removed, the command linuxmuster-linuxclient7 clean is executed. It does the following:
- Clear user cache
- Clear / leave domain join
- Clear /etc/pam.d/common-session:
- Remove lines containing one of
["pam_mkhomedir.so", "pam_exec.so", "pam_mount.so", "linuxmuster.net", "linuxmuster-linuxclient7"]. - This will prevent a logon brick